Molinia caerulea subsp. caerulea 'Moorhexe'

Molinia caerulea subsp. caerulea 'Moorhexe' is a Purple moor grass with greyish green upright leaves and dark purple-grey spikelets.

PLANT SPECIFICS
Pot Size 2 litre pot
Width 50cm
Height 50cm
Family Poaceae
Flowering Summer to late autumn
Garden habitat sun or partial shade
Soil fertile, well drained soil
Plant category Grass
